RMWB Council has approved a new Land Use Bylaw, set to take effect on January 1, 2026. The updated bylaw aligns with the Municipal Development Plan and aims to support local businesses, responsible development, and economic growth. Key updates include simplified language, more flexible regulations, new land use districts, and expanded options for secondary suites and larger accessory buildings. The bylaw also introduces improved accessibility features, such as senior parking for commercial developments. These changes aim to streamline development and reduce red tape. All development applications will follow the current bylaw until January 2026.
